A tiny themed restaurant that opened in London in 1971 has since grown into a global mega-franchise with 185 cafes, more than two dozen hotels, and numerous casinos. When they couldn't find a nice burger in the UK, two Americans, Isaac Tigrett and Peter Morton, decided to create their own business. The cafes are well-known for both their huge collections of rock 'n' roll memorabilia that are displayed on every available wall in the eateries and for the frequent live performances that take place at several of the locations. Burgers, fries, sandwiches, steaks, and other traditional American fare typically make up the menu. Ruby Tuesday is a casual eating establishment featuring predominantly American-style food that includes fried appetisers, sandwiches, steaks, pastas, and burgers. It was founded in Knoxville, Tennessee, in 1972. Although there are no recognised connections to the band, the name Ruby Tuesday was inspired by a song by the Rolling Stones of the same name. There are already more than 200 locations both domestically and abroad. Sandy Beall III, the company's original founder, left in 2012.
